Institutions providing secondhand merchandise at decreased costs are prevalent within the Yuma, Arizona space. These shops usually purchase their stock by donations and infrequently assist charitable causes with their proceeds.
Such retail places present financial advantages to the neighborhood by providing inexpensive items to budget-conscious shoppers. In addition they promote sustainability by extending the lifespan of usable objects, diverting them from landfills and lowering the demand for brand spanking new manufacturing. Traditionally, these kind of shops have served as important sources in periods of financial hardship, providing important items to these in want.
